Telematics

- Telematics has become very popular with luxury and high end cars. Today the telematics industry has grown tremendously from what it was five years ago. Voice recognition in telematics has become a key feature for navigation. Passengers can easily assign voice commands instead of pushing keys while driving, making driving safe and comfortable.

- Voice commands instructed to the telematics instrument are transmitted to the nearby satellite. This transmission of the voice commands can choke bandwidth space if the voice is not compressed enough. MASC can solve this problem as it does not only provide high compressed voice but also high perceptual quality.

- Some of these voice commands can be archived so that repeated instructions can be easily recognized. Archiving of large amounts of voice needs storage space and MASC, with its high quality voice and small foot print, can save storage space for archived voice files.

- MASC has been tested and is proven to be robust in noisy environments such as in cars for telematics applications. MASC has produced low Word Error rates compared to other competitive speech codecs as it filters out noise components in the voice efficiently making it suitable for voice recognition in telematics applications.
